DIGITALIS 'ANNE REDETZKY'
|
Family: Scrophulariaceae
Height(approx.): 2-3ft
An intriguing and novel dwarf foxglove. The whole of the creamy trumpet flower is cut in several places along its length, which then reflexes back, producing an almost orchid-like appearance. The most attractive digitalis of all.
Sowing advice: A. SOW FINELY AND EVENLY. COVER THINLY WITH COMPOST OR GRIT. GERMINATE IN GENTLE HEAT OR IN A WARM BRIGHT SPOT OUTSIDE. GROW-ON INDIVIDUAL SEEDLINGS IN 3 INCH POTS BEFORE PLANTING OUT.
